Looks good man. What fabric did you use and how did you do it? Contact cement?

Thanks,

I basically removed the 6 panels and cleaned them up. I then wiped them down with rubbing alcohol as well. I went to a local fabric store(s) until I found something I liked and would flow with my car. Make sure you cut a piece to wrap that piece of the panel before doing anything with the adhesive. Once you get the piece cut (leave some overlap).  I used 3M 77 Multi Purpose spray adhesive. The trick is to spray the piece evenly and wait 30 seconds before applying fabric. Try to get it on as evenely as possible so you have no ripples in the fabric, smooth and lift as needed. Do this to all pieces and when your done reinstall into your car. As for the fabric I used a thicker piece. It almost feels like micro suede... Don't get the fabric to thick as you won't be able to secure the panels in place securley. The poject should take around 30-45 minutes tops  Wink and will definetly add some appeal to your interior.
